Transaction d81be01070e5e015fa549ce246f3e04e12cf7885ed991c09abce48e3c6cd637a

3 Input
2 Outputs
  • d81be01070e5e015fa549ce246f3e04e12cf7885ed991c09abce48e3c6cd637a:0
  • value  1002831
    address  34k2QrraxHoDgYZWbk8aLXCRcd6B9NMgKv
  • d81be01070e5e015fa549ce246f3e04e12cf7885ed991c09abce48e3c6cd637a:1
  • value  340670
    address  1FtMs4P67nhTNqq9pV4CAWYRtzx2DbMLXV